In response to this trend, it is imperative to formulate a comprehensive long-term energy development strategy.<\/li><li>At the heart of sustainable energy development lie two key principles: energy conservation and the increased utilization of renewable energy sources.\u00a0<\/li><li>Recognizing the importance of energy conservation, the Energy Conservation (EC) Act was enacted in 2001 with the aim of reducing the energy intensity of the Indian economy.\u00a0<\/li><li>To facilitate the implementation of the Energy Conservation Act, the Bureau of Energy Efficiency (BEE) was established as a statutory body at the federal level in 2002.\u00a0<\/li><li>Operating under the purview of the Ministry of Power, the BEE plays a crucial role in promoting energy efficiency initiatives across various sectors.<\/li><li>Looking ahead, projections indicate that India&#8217;s energy consumption is expected to quadruple by 2030, reaching nearly 1500 million tonnes of oil equivalent.\u00a0<\/li><li>In response to this growing demand, the Energy Conservation Act of 2001 (ECA) lays down regulatory requirements aimed at promoting energy efficiency.\u00a0<\/li><li>These requirements include standards and labeling for equipment and appliances, energy conservation rules for commercial buildings, and energy consumption standards for energy-intensive sectors.\u00a0<\/li><li>Through such legislative measures and proactive initiatives, India aims to enhance energy efficiency, reduce its environmental footprint, and foster sustainable economic growth.<\/li><\/ul>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"FAQs_about_Energy_Sources_and_Conservation\"><\/span><strong>FAQs about Energy Sources and Conservation<\/strong><span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"1_What_are_energy_resources_and_why_are_they_essential_for_economic_growth\"><\/span>1.
